Bug#703506: GMA500: higher resolutions than 800x600 don't work



Quoting myself:

Georg Sassen <debianbugs@georgsassen.de> wrote:

> It seems CONFIG_DRM_GMA500 (and maybe CONFIG_STUB_POULSBO) is not set
> in the kernel config, so the gma500_gfx is not built at all, maybe
> because of the name change from psb_gfx which was loaded with the
> 3.2.35 kernel.
> 
> I enabled the config options, and now the little machine is compiling
> a new kernel, which might take some time though...
> 
> I will tell if it works.

Yes, it does, with CONFIG_DRM_GMA500 and CONFIG_STUB_POULSBO enabled,
gma500_gfx.ko is built and the native resolution working again.

I haven't yet managed to control the backlight brightness, though,
poulsbo.ko is loaded but doesn't seem to have any effect. Maybe I have
to tweak the kernel cmdline again, will have a look later.

So, IMHO it would be nice if these options were in the default kernel
config again to make those little laptops more usable.
